Taking into consideration the dangerous exploits of Internet browsing by uneducated and unaware employees, GFI conducted a survey among the small- to medium-sized businesses (SMBs).
A survey conducted by GFI Software among the top heads of 200 IT decision-makers of SMBs revealed that 40% of their businesses experienced a security breach due to employees' indulgence in social networking sites. According to 55% of users, employing web monitoring defense against online malware protection website does not hold a prime importance, as reported by scmagazineuk.com on October 12, 2011.
Information on percentage of SMBs deploying a security solution reveals that nearly a quarter (24%) utilize it primarily for ensuring employee productivity, whereas 13.5% use it for preserving network bandwidth and speed.
